summaryrefslogtreecommitdiff
path: root/debian/strongswan-starter.prerm
diff options
context:
space:
mode:
authorRene Mayrhofer <rene@mayrhofer.eu.org>2009-03-26 16:03:13 +0000
committerRene Mayrhofer <rene@mayrhofer.eu.org>2009-03-26 16:03:13 +0000
commit49bf9e74e53dbed0079595f8a6fb9f1aa8247de3 (patch)
treebc8fe341de61027426e2814559b0a7b57d130fe1 /debian/strongswan-starter.prerm
parent9e964aaea512fd10456eff0ac4152d47e87748eb (diff)
downloadvyos-strongswan-49bf9e74e53dbed0079595f8a6fb9f1aa8247de3.tar.gz
vyos-strongswan-49bf9e74e53dbed0079595f8a6fb9f1aa8247de3.zip
- Modularize: move stuff to sub-packages.
Diffstat (limited to 'debian/strongswan-starter.prerm')
-rw-r--r--debian/strongswan-starter.prerm40
1 files changed, 40 insertions, 0 deletions
diff --git a/debian/strongswan-starter.prerm b/debian/strongswan-starter.prerm
new file mode 100644
index 000000000..c1ba063d6
--- /dev/null
+++ b/debian/strongswan-starter.prerm
@@ -0,0 +1,40 @@
+#! /bin/sh
+# prerm script for strongswan
+#
+# see: dh_installdeb(1)
+
+set -e
+
+# summary of how this script can be called:
+# * <prerm> `remove'
+# * <old-prerm> `upgrade' <new-version>
+# * <new-prerm> `failed-upgrade' <old-version>
+# * <conflictor's-prerm> `remove' `in-favour' <package> <new-version>
+# * <deconfigured's-prerm> `deconfigure' `in-favour'
+# <package-being-installed> <version> `removing'
+# <conflicting-package> <version>
+# for details, see /usr/share/doc/packaging-manual/
+
+case "$1" in
+ upgrade)
+ ;;
+ remove|deconfigure)
+ invoke-rc.d ipsec stop || true
+# install-info --quiet --remove /usr/info/strongswan.info.gz
+ ;;
+ failed-upgrade)
+ ;;
+ *)
+ echo "prerm called with unknown argument \`$1'" >&2
+ exit 0
+ ;;
+esac
+
+# dh_installdeb will replace this with shell code automatically
+# generated by other debhelper scripts.
+
+#DEBHELPER#
+
+exit 0
+
+